Cross Country Places 18th at Geneseo

Cross Country Places 18th at Geneseo

The Alfred State cross country team each finished 18th at the SUNY Geneseo Invitational at Letchworth Park on Saturday.  The men scored a 526 while the women scored a 607.

Jordan Rusek (Williamsville East) led the Pioneer men with a 135th place finish.  He finished the 8k course in 28:11.8.  Joe Seitz (Williamsville) finished 146 (28:26.6), James Westman (Fonda-Fultonville) was 148 (28:28.3), and Dominic Freudenvoll (Greece Arcadia) was 182 (29:15.3). Kyle Glaub (West Seneca) was fifth man in with a 222nd place finish (30:42.9).

The Geneseo men won the overall title with a score of 34.  20 teams competed in the race.

Kim Lupo (Auburn) led the women in the 6k course with a 204th place finish (26:32.4).  Kelly Healy (Maple Hill) was 230 (27:20.3), Mikaela Shaw (Attica) was 251 (29:22.1), and Leah Foley (Marion) was 256 (29:57.5).  Katherine Gelser (Keshequa) was fifth in for Alfred State with a 268th place finish (34:48.7).

Geneseo also took the women's title with a score of 55.  Athletes from 20 teams competed in the race.

The Pioneers have a few weeks off before competing at the New York Championships on October 26th at Hamilton College.
